TV Prices Drop and 360 Cam Tech Advances Before Black Friday | #183

Popular Technology Radio is back as Thanksgiving, Black Friday, and Cyber Monday draw closer, promising amazing deals on everything from 360 cameras to TV sets. First off, Mike Etchart gets back in the pilot's chair, contrasts the prices of TVs today with plasma sets of 20 years ago, and gets us ready for CES and NAMM in January 2019. Then, Geoff Morrison tells us why heavily discounted televisions during the Black Friday weekend aren't as good of deals as we may be lead to believe. Next, we dive into how TVs have gotten as inexpensive as they have due to the natural progression of manufacturing technology. Changing topics, Geoff describes why Insta360's One X is the best camera on the market. Closing the show, we discuss LG's monopoly on OLED TV manufacturing technology, and why Samsung can't get a foothold in this market. Tune in and get ready for Black Friday!

  • [00:00:00] Mike Etchart, Back in the Pilot's Seat
  • [00:07:10] Discount TVs, Not As Good As You Think
  • [00:12:30] Asian Manufacturing Power Shifts
  • [00:19:51] Lack of Name Brand Recognition in China
  • [00:28:22] The Wirecutter Loves Insta360's One X
  • [00:35:51] LG's Monopoly On OLED
